Welcome to the ChronoGate maintenance rotation. The mat-side chip reader at the Feldmoor Marathon runs the StrideSync firmware and reports splits to the Pacebook aggregator every two seconds. Future maintainers should know that the reader's config store is encrypted at rest; if the unit is power-cycled more than three times in an hour, it locks and must be re-provisioned from the sealed recovery profile. To unseal the profile on a replacement unit, enter the passphrase below.

unlock words, kajef-kadug: sorys-pelax-lamael-tamvan-briiel-novdor-fenwyn-tamdor-oliion-keleth-julok-belion-ralok

Subject: Key rotation for the Lockstitch formatting service

As part of this quarter's rotation schedule, the key used by our date-localization pipeline has been replaced. Please verify that the review branch for the new locale-aware formatter points at the updated credential before approving. The old key stops working Friday. The new key for the Lockstitch staging environment is below.

API key for yahig-tadup: kto7_ubizbYm

### Step 4: Tune cold-start behavior

After moving your plugin onto the Fennelgate serverless runtime, handlers will experience cold starts whenever a worker is recycled. Version 3 changes this: provisioned warm pools are now opt-in per handler, and the init timeout is enforced strictly. Plugins that lazily load large models should move that work into the declared init phase. To opt in, set the pool values in your manifest as shown below.

settings of bawif-fawif:
ralix:
  log_level: warn
  metrics_host: metrics.ralix.tolvaqsys.internal
  pool_size: 32

## Deployment

Tailhawk, our internal CLI for tailing service logs, ships as a single static binary built by the Larkspur pipeline. Deploy it to the jumphost pool only; it must never run on production app nodes, since it opens a persistent stream to the log broker. After copying the binary, create the runtime directory, set ownership to the tailhawk service account, and verify broker connectivity. The daemon reads its settings from the environment shown below.

config for hahip-kaguf:
[holath]
port = 8443
region = north-4
host = holath.tolvaqlabs.internal
timeout_ms = 1000
retries = 2